Abstract

Process for the preparation of styrene, by dehydrogenation of ethylbenzene in the presence of a metal oxide catalyst, characterized in that a catalyst whose active component is deposited on an inert support in the form of a layer of 0.01 to 2 mm. Thickness. (Machine-translation by Google Translate, not legally binding)
